Section 457.348 - Determinations of Children's Health Insurance Program eligibility by other insurance affordability programs
(a)Agreements with other insurance affordability programs. The State must enter into and, upon request, provide to the Secretary one or more agreements with an Exchange and the agencies administering other insurance affordability programs as are necessary to fulfill the requirements of this section, including a clear delineation of the responsibilities of each program to-
(1) Minimize burden on individuals seeking to obtain or renew eligibility or to appeal a determination of eligibility for one or more insurance affordability program;
(2) Ensure compliance with paragraphs (b) and (c) of this section and § 457.350 ;
(3) Ensure prompt determination of eligibility and enrollment in the appropriate program without undue delay, consistent with the timeliness standards established under § 457.340(d) , based on the date the application is submitted to any insurance affordability program, and
(4) Provide for a combined eligibility notice and coordination of notices with other insurance affordability programs, consistent with § 457.340(f) , and an opportunity for individuals to submit a joint review request, as defined in § 457.10 , consistent with § 457.351 .
(5) Provide for a combined appeals decision by an Exchange or Exchange appeals entity (or other insurance affordability program or appeals entity) for individuals who requested an appeal of an Exchange-related determination in accordance with 45 CFR part 155 subpart F (or of a determination related to another program) and an appeal of a denial of CHIP eligibility which is conducted by an Exchange or Exchange appeals entity (or other program or appeals entity) in accordance with the State plan.
(6) Seamlessly transition the enrollment of beneficiaries between CHIP and Medicaid when a beneficiary is determined eligible for one program by the agency administering the other.
(b)Provision of CHIP for individuals found eligible for CHIP by another insurance affordability program.
(1) For each individual determined CHIP eligible in accordance with paragraph (b)(2) of this section, the State must-
(i) Establish procedures to receive, via secure electronic interface, the electronic account containing the determination of CHIP eligibility and notify such program of the receipt of the electronic account;
(ii) Comply with the provisions of § 457.340 to the same extent as if the application had been submitted to the State; and
(iii) Maintain proper oversight of the eligibility determinations made by the other program.
(2) For purposes of paragraph (b)(1) of this section, individuals determined eligible for CHIP in this paragraph (b) include:
(i) Individuals determined eligible for CHIP by another insurance affordability program, including the Exchange, pursuant to an agreement between the State and the other insurance affordability program (including as a result of a decision made by the program or the program's appeal entity in accordance with paragraph (a) of this section); and
(ii) Individuals determined eligible for CHIP by the State Medicaid agency (including as the result of a decision made by the Medicaid appeals entity) in accordance with paragraph (e) of this section.
(c)Transfer from other insurance affordability programs to CHIP. For individuals for whom another insurance affordability program has not made a determination of CHIP eligibility, but who have been screened as potentially CHIP eligible by such program (including as a result of a decision made by an Exchange or other program appeals entity), the State must-
(1) Accept, via secure electronic interface, the electronic account for the individual and notify such program of the receipt of the electronic account;
(2) Not request information or documentation from the individual in the individual's electronic account, or provided to the State by another insurance affordability program or appeals entity;
(3) Promptly and without undue delay, consistent with the timeliness standards established under § 457.340(d) , determine the CHIP eligibility of the individual, in accordance with § 457.340 , without requiring submission of another application and, for individuals determined not eligible for CHIP, comply with § 457.350(g) of this section;
(4) Accept any finding relating to a criterion of eligibility made by such program or appeals entity, without further verification, if such finding was made in accordance with policies and procedures which are the same as those applied by the State in accordance with § 457.380 or approved by it in the agreement described in paragraph (a) of this section; and
(5) Notify such program of the final determination of the individual's eligibility or ineligibility for CHIP.
(d)Certification of eligibility criteria. The State must certify for the Exchange and other insurance affordability programs the criteria applied in determining CHIP eligibility.
(e)CHIP determinations made by other insurance affordability programs. The State must accept a determination of eligibility for CHIP from the Medicaid agency in the State. In order to comply with the requirement in this paragraph (e), the agency may:
(1) Apply the same modified adjusted gross income (MAGI)-based methodologies in accordance with § 457.315 , and verification policies and procedures in accordance with § 457.380 as those used by the Medicaid agency in accordance with §§ 435.940 through 435.956 of this chapter, such that the agency will accept any finding relating to a criterion of eligibility made by a Medicaid agency without further verification;
(2) Enter into an agreement under which the State delegates authority to the Medicaid agency to make final determinations of CHIP eligibility; or
(3) Adopt other procedures approved by the Secretary.
